The plasmid also contains an oriT, which enables its conjugal transfer from E. coli to Streptomyces. In addition, it can integrate into the Streptomyces chromosome through site-specific recombination between the pSAM2 site within the vector and the corresponding site of the chromosome. This ...

The encoded protein is a type I transmembrane protein that has immunoglobulin V-like and C-like domains. Interaction of this ligand with its receptor inhibits T-cell activation and cytokine production. During infection or inflammation of normal tissue, this interaction is important for pr...
